<4> Revenue Growth and Profitability
Prysmian’s Q4 revenue stood at €4.3 billion, representing a 2% increase compared to the same period last year. However, the company’s profitability took a hit, with an operating margin of 6.3%, down from 7.2% in Q4 2022. The decline in profitability can be attributed to higher raw material costs, increased energy prices, and a stronger euro.
